A Useful Compendium of Legal Maxims and Phrases
Originally published: London: Sweet & Maxwell, 1915. viii, 300 pp. The perfect book for that considerable number of law students and lawyers with little or no knowledge of Latin. For those already proficient in Latin, the interest in this volume will lie in the large collection of legal maxims and phrases. The annotations are commendable for their brevity and unpretentious simplicity.
E. Hilton Jackson [1869-1950] was a Latin instructor at Columbia University.


Latin for Lawyers. Containing I: A Course in Latin, with Legal Maxims and Phrases As a Basis of Instruction. II. A Collection of Over One Thousand … III. A Vocabulary of Latin Words.
